What is the Instalment Savings Application Form?
The Instalment Savings Application Form is a vital document provided by the National Treasury Management Agency (NTMA) in Ireland. Its primary purpose is to facilitate regular monthly savings for individuals, allowing them to systematically build their savings over a fixed period. By encouraging consistency in deposits, this form plays a crucial role in personal finance management.
Purpose and Benefits of the Instalment Savings Application Form
This form offers several notable advantages for savings enthusiasts. One key benefit is the ability to earn tax-free interest on accumulated savings. Additionally, using the instalment savings application form instills a sense of financial discipline, fostering a savings habit over a predetermined duration, which can significantly enhance one's financial health.

Eligibility Criteria for the Instalment Savings Application Form
To apply for the instalment savings application form, individuals must meet specific eligibility criteria. Applicants must be at least 18 years old; those under this age require parental consent. Joint account applications are also permissible, provided the required documentation is submitted.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Instalment Savings Application Form?
To qualify, applicants must be at least 18 years of age or minors with parental consent. All applicants should be residents of Ireland.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Instalment Savings Application Form?
While there is no specific submission deadline, it is advisable to apply as soon as possible to start your savings plan without delay.

What supporting documents are required with the Instalment Savings Application Form?
Typically, no additional documents are required with this application. However, be prepared to provide identification information such as your PPSN.
